Live fire near school in Russia (standoff)
CNN ^ | September 3, 2004

Posted on 09/03/2004 2:21:29 AM PDT by Former Military Chick

BESLAN, Russia (CNN) -- Hundreds more hostages may be inside a school under siege in southern Russian than first thought, Russian officials have said.

As the crisis entered its third day Friday, a spokesman for the regional government told CNN an earlier estimate of 350 hostages was low.

Two of 26 hostages freed by their captors on Thursday indicated there were 1,000 children, parents and teachers inside the building in Beslan, near the troubled Russian republic of Chechnya.

Relatives waiting outside the school also have said there could be as many as 1,000 hostages, noting that the school has 11 grades with 75-100 students in each grade.

Asked about the discrepancy with the earlier estimate, the regional government spokesman said officials originally accounted only for those children whose parents reported them missing.

But teachers also were in the school when armed attackers seized the building Wednesday morning.

And many of the children -- especially in the lower grades -- were accompanied by their parents and in some cases entire families for a celebration to mark the start of the school year.

"The situation in school very, very dire," CNN's Ryan Chilcote reported from the scene.

"Two of the 26 women and children released yesterday are saying the situation is very bad inside the school's gymnasium where the hostages are being kept.

"At one point the men were separated from the women and children. The men were then brought back into the gymnasium, but there weren't as many of them, and there's no word what happened to the other men."

"There is no food and water. At one point the hostage-takers brought them one cup of water for, as they put it, 1,000 hostages."
